Why Secondary Data?

Context (geographic, temporal, social) for primary data.

Secondary data may provide validation for primary data

Secondary data may act as a substitute for primary data.

Census Geographical Hierarchy

RegionDivision State

County County subdivision

Place (or part) Census tract (or part)

Block group (or part) 9 mio. Census blocks

TIGER

Topologically Integrated Geographic Encoding and Referencing system

Based on USGS topographic maps but majorly augmented

Contains no elevation data

No copyright

No street names

Pro’s and Con’s of Secondary Data

Advantages Cheap Timeliness Access to

people/organizations that we wouldn’t have access to otherwise

Less post-processing

Disadvantages

Collection method unknown

Lack of control
